"""Gemma-4-E2B-it inference with flex_attention + paged KV cache + CUDA graphs.
|
|
|
|
Extends the Qwen3/Llama-3.2 engine in `qwen3_flex_inference.py` to a third
|
|
architecture, `unsloth/gemma-4-E2B-it`. Gemma-4 is not a drop-in addition:
|
|
its text backbone diverges from Qwen3/Llama in ways that cannot be folded
|
|
into a single `hasattr(self, "q_norm")` branch. The divergences, and how
|
|
this file handles them:
|
|
|
|
1. KV-sharing layers. E2B has 35 layers; the upper 15 lack `k_proj`,
|
|
`v_proj`, `k_norm`, `v_norm` entirely and consume the K/V produced
|
|
by a "store" layer further up the stack. We link each shared layer's
|
|
`_paged_cache` to the store layer's `PagedKVCache` so flex_attention
|
|
reads the same pages that the store layer populated a few layers
|
|
earlier -- no sidecar, no SDPA fallback, one block mask per regime
|
|
works for every layer.
|
|
2. Dual attention types. Each layer is either `full_attention`
|
|
(`head_dim=512`, `rope_theta=1e6`, `partial_rotary_factor=0.25`) or
|
|
`sliding_attention` (`head_dim=256`, `rope_theta=10000`,
|
|
`sliding_window=512`). We precompute both (cos, sin) pairs once per
|
|
forward and dispatch on `self.layer_type`.
|
|
3. Per-layer input embeddings. `embed_tokens_per_layer` produces a
|
|
`[B, S, num_layers, 256]` auxiliary table that enters every layer
|
|
through a `per_layer_input_gate -> act -> mul -> per_layer_projection
|
|
-> post_per_layer_input_norm -> +residual` path after the MLP residual.
|
|
4. Four norms per layer. `input_layernorm` / `post_attention_layernorm`
|
|
wrap the attention block (double residual); `pre_feedforward_layernorm`
|
|
/ `post_feedforward_layernorm` wrap the MLP (double residual). A scalar
|
|
`layer_scalar` multiplies hidden_states at layer end.
|
|
5. Final logit softcap. `logits = tanh(logits / 30.0) * 30.0` applied on
|
|
the lm_head output.
|
|
|
|
The engine is text-only: `Gemma4ForCausalLM(text_config)` skips the
|
|
multimodal `Gemma4ForConditionalGeneration` wrapper and its vision + audio
|
|
towers entirely. Shared helpers (`PagedKVCache`, `PageTable`, `Sequence`,
|
|
`refresh_lora_merge_from_pristine`, `run_drift_verification`,
|
|
`flex_attention_compiled`, `_apply_rotary`, FA4 capability guard) are
|
|
imported from `qwen3_flex_inference.py` unchanged.
